HOW TO USE

Hair Alchemy Resilience Shampoo: Lather, indulge, rinse.

Hair Alchemy Resilience Conditioner: Massage, indulge (for at least one minute), rinse.

Hair Alchemy Treatment Serum: Work a small amount into damp or dry hair to strengthen. Style as usual. Can also be used as an overnight treatment.

ABOUT THE ARTWORK

In “Eternal Rituals” via a sprawling three-part tapestry, Louis showcases the central role that haircare has played in our daily life since antiquity. The whimsical narrative visualizes thousands of years of haircare ritual, starting with a sublime deity, whose hair flows upwards like the life-giving Nile river. Under the watchful eye of the god Horus, the flowing locks are tended to and braided by mythical Egyptian gods and goddesses, surrounded by lush flora and fauna, all with playful nods to Oribe throughout.
